---- Jeremiah 39:1 ---- written 627-585 B.C. Pre-Exilic----
Jer 39:1 -- efter det att Nebukadressar, konungen i Babel, med hela sin här hade kommit till Jer salem och begynt belägra det i Sidkia, Juda konungs, nionde regeringsår, i tionde månaden,(Swedish-1917)
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Jer 39:1 Now when Jerusalem was captured in the ninth year of Zedekiah king of Judah, in the tenth month, Nebuchadnezzar king of Babylon and all his army came to Jerusalem and laid siege to it;(NASB-1995)

================================================================================
---- Jeremiah 39:2----
Jer 39:2 och efter det att staden; hade blivit stormad i Sidkias elfte regeringsår, i fjärde månaden, på nionde dagen månaden(Swedish-1917)
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Jer 39:2 in the eleventh year of Zedekiah, in the fourth month, in the ninth day of the month, the city wall was breached.(NASB-1995)

================================================================================
---- Jeremiah 39:3----
Jer 39:3 drogo alla den babyloniske konungens furstar därin och stannade i Mellersta porten: nämligen Nergal Sareser, Samgar-Nebo, Sarsekim, överste hovmannen, Nergal-Sareser, överste magern, och alla den babyloniske konungens övriga furstar.(Swedish-1917)
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Jer 39:3 Then all the officials of the king of Babylon came in and sat down at the Middle Gate: Nergal-sar-ezer, Samgar-nebu, Sar-sekim the Rab-saris, Nergal-sar-ezer the Rab-mag, and all the rest of the officials of the king of Babylon.(NASB-1995)

================================================================================
---- Jeremiah 39:4----
Jer 39:4 Och när Sidkia, Juda konung, med allt sitt krigsfolk fick se dem, flydde de och drogo om natten ut ur staden, på den väg som ledde till den kungliga trädgården, genom porten mellan de båda murarna; och han tog vägen bort åt Hedmarken till.(Swedish-1917)
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Jer 39:4 When Zedekiah the king of Judah and all the men of war saw them, they fled and went out of the city at night by way of the king's garden through the gate between the two walls; and he went out toward the Arabah.(NASB-1995)

================================================================================
---- Jeremiah 39:5----
Jer 39:5 Men kaldéernas här förföljde dem och de hunno upp Sidkia på Jer ko hedmarker. Och de togo fatt honom och förde honom till Nebukadressar, den babyloniske konungen, i Ribla i Hamats land; där höll denne rannsakning och dom med honom.(Swedish-1917)
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Jer 39:5 But the army of the Chaldeans pursued them and overtook Zedekiah in the plains of Jericho; and they seized him and brought him up to Nebuchadnezzar king of Babylon at Riblah in the land of Hamath, and he passed sentence on him.(NASB-1995)

================================================================================
---- Jeremiah 39:6----
Jer 39:6 Och den babyloniske konungen lät i Ribla slakta Sidkias barn inför hans ögon; också alla andra Juda ädlingar lät konungen i Babel slakta.(Swedish-1917)
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Jer 39:6 Then the king of Babylon slew the sons of Zedekiah before his eyes at Riblah; the king of Babylon also slew all the nobles of Judah.(NASB-1995)

================================================================================
---- Jeremiah 39:7----
Jer 39:7 Och på Sidkia själv lät han sticka ut ögonen och lät fängsla honom med kopparfjättrar, för att föra honom till Babel.(Swedish-1917)
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Jer 39:7 He then blinded Zedekiah's eyes and bound him in fetters of bronze to bring him to Babylon.(NASB-1995)

================================================================================
---- Jeremiah 39:8----
Jer 39:8 Och kaldéerna brände upp i eld både konungens hus och folkets hus och bröto ned Jer salems murar.(Swedish-1917)
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Jer 39:8 The Chaldeans also burned with fire the king's palace and the houses of the people, and they broke down the walls of Jerusalem.(NASB-1995)

================================================================================
---- Jeremiah 39:9----
Jer 39:9 Och återstoden av folket, dem som voro kvar i staden, och de över löpare som hade gått över till honom, och vad som för övrigt var kvar av folket, dem förde Nebusaradan, översten för drabanterna, bort till Babel.(Swedish-1917)
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Jer 39:9 As for the rest of the people who were left in the city, the deserters who had gone over to him and the rest of the people who remained, Nebuzaradan the captain of the bodyguard carried them into exile in Babylon.(NASB-1995)

================================================================================
---- Jeremiah 39:10----
Jer 39:10 Men av de ringaste bland folket, av dem som ingenting hade, lämnade Nebusaradan, översten för drabanterna, några kvar i Juda land, och gav dem samtidigt vingårdar och åkerfält.(Swedish-1917)
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Jer 39:10 But some of the poorest people who had nothing, Nebuzaradan the captain of the bodyguard left behind in the land of Judah, and gave them vineyards and fields at that time.(NASB-1995)

================================================================================
---- Jeremiah 39:11----
Jer 39:11 Och Nebukadressar, konungen Babel, gav genom Nebusaradan, översten för drabanterna, befallning angående Jer mia och sade:(Swedish-1917)
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Jer 39:11 Now Nebuchadnezzar king of Babylon gave orders about Jeremiah through Nebuzaradan the captain of the bodyguard, saying,(NASB-1995)

================================================================================
---- Jeremiah 39:12----
Jer 39:12 »Tag honom och se i honom till godo, och gör honom icke något ont, utan gör med honom efter som han själv begär av dig.»(Swedish-1917)
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Jer 39:12 "Take him and look after him, and do nothing harmful to him, but rather deal with him just as he tells you."(NASB-1995)

================================================================================
---- Jeremiah 39:13----
Jer 39:13 Då sände Nebusaradan, översten för drabanterna, och Nebusasban, överste hovmannen, och Nergal-Sareser, överste magern, och alla den babyloniske konungens övriga väldige --(Swedish-1917)
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Jer 39:13 So Nebuzaradan the captain of the bodyguard sent word, along with Nebushazban the Rab-saris, and Nergal-sar-ezer the Rab-mag, and all the leading officers of the king of Babylon;(NASB-1995)

================================================================================
---- Jeremiah 39:14----
Jer 39:14 dessa sände bort och läto hämta Jer mia ifrån fängelsegården och lämnade honom åt Gedalja, son till Ahikam, son till Safan, på det att denne skulle föra honom hem; så fick han stanna där bland folket.(Swedish-1917)
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Jer 39:14 they even sent and took Jeremiah out of the court of the guardhouse and entrusted him to Gedaliah, the son of Ahikam, the son of Shaphan, to take him home. So he stayed among the people.(NASB-1995)

================================================================================
---- Jeremiah 39:15----
Jer 39:15 Men HERRENS ord hade kommit till Jer mia, medan han var inspärrad i fängelsegården; han hade sagt:(Swedish-1917)
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Jer 39:15 Now the word of the Lord had come to Jeremiah while he was confined in the court of the guardhouse, saying,(NASB-1995)

================================================================================
---- Jeremiah 39:16----
Jer 39:16 Gå och säg till etiopiern Ebed-Melek: Så säger HERREN Sebaot, Israels Gud: Se, vad jag har förkunnat, det skall jag låta komma över denna stad, till dess olycka och icke till dess lycka, och det skall uppfyllas i din åsyn på den dagen.(Swedish-1917)
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Jer 39:16 "Go and speak to Ebed-melech the Ethiopian, saying, 'Thus says the Lord of hosts, the God of Israel," Behold, I am about to bring My words on this city for disaster and not for prosperity; and they will take place before you on that day.(NASB-1995)

================================================================================
---- Jeremiah 39:17----
Jer 39:17 Men dig skall jag rädda på den dagen, säger HERREN, och du skall icke bliva given i de mäns hand, som du fruktar för.(Swedish-1917)
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Jer 39:17 But I will deliver you on that day," declares the Lord,"and you will not be given into the hand of the men whom you dread.(NASB-1995)

================================================================================
---- Jeremiah 39:18----
Jer 39:18 Ty jag skall förvisso låta dig komma undan, och du skall icke falla för svärd, utan vinna ditt liv såsom ett byte, därför att du har förtröstat på mig, säger HERREN.(Swedish-1917)
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Jer 39:18 For I will certainly rescue you, and you will not fall by the sword; but you will have your own life as booty, because you have trusted in Me," declares the Lord.'"(NASB-1995)
